1. Fatty Fish

Fatty fish such as salmon, mackerel, and sardines are rich in omega-3 fatty acids, which are known for their anti-inflammatory properties. Omega-3s help reduce joint stiffness and pain by decreasing the production of inflammatory chemicals in the body. Additionally, these fatty acids support the repair of joint tissues, making them an excellent choice for those suffering from knee pain.

Regular consumption of fatty fish can provide significant relief from joint pain. Aim to include at least two servings of fatty fish per week to reap the benefits of omega-3s. If you’re not a fan of fish, consider taking a fish oil supplement as an alternative source of these beneficial fats.

2. Leafy Green Vegetables

Leafy green vegetables like spinach, kale, and broccoli are packed with antioxidants and vitamins that promote joint health. These vegetables contain vitamin C, vitamin K, and calcium, all of which are essential for maintaining strong bones and cartilage. Antioxidants found in leafy greens help combat oxidative stress, a factor that can contribute to joint inflammation and damage.

Incorporating a variety of leafy greens into your diet can help reduce knee pain and improve mobility. Consider adding these vegetables to salads, smoothies, or as side dishes to ensure you receive their full nutritional benefits.

3. Nuts and Seeds

Nuts and seeds, such as almonds, walnuts, and chia seeds, are excellent sources of healthy fats, protein, and fiber. They also contain antioxidants and anti-inflammatory compounds that support joint health. Walnuts, in particular, are high in omega-3 fatty acids, making them a great addition to a joint-friendly diet.

Including a handful of nuts and seeds in your daily diet can help reduce inflammation and provide essential nutrients for joint repair. These foods are versatile and can be enjoyed as snacks, added to yogurt, or incorporated into baking recipes.

Self-monitored home security systems empower homeowners to take control of their safety without relying on external monitoring services. These systems typically include a hub, sensors, cameras, and mobile app integration, allowing users to receive alerts and view live footage from anywhere. The absence of monthly fees makes them an attractive option for budget-conscious individuals. Additionally, many systems are DIY-friendly, eliminating the need for professional installation. Below, we delve into the key aspects of self-monitored systems, including their components, benefits, and top recommendations. Key Components of Self-Monitored Systems Self-monitored systems consist of several essential components that work together to provide comprehensive security. The central hub acts as the brain of the system, connecting all devices and facilitating communication. Door and window sensors detect unauthorized entry, while motion sensors monitor movement within the home. Cameras, both indoor and outdoor, offer visual verification of alerts. Many systems also include environmental sensors for smoke, carbon monoxide, and water leaks. Mobile App Integration Most self-monitored systems come with a dedicated mobile app, enabling users to control their security setup remotely. These apps allow for real-time notifications, live video streaming, and system arming/disarming. Some apps even support geofencing, which automatically arms or disarms the system based on the user’s location.

Household virtual phone systems, or home VoIP services, have emerged as a popular alternative to traditional landlines. These systems use internet connectivity to transmit voice calls, offering superior call quality, flexibility, and affordability. With features like call forwarding, voicemail transcription, and virtual numbers, home VoIP services cater to both personal and professional communication needs. They are particularly beneficial for remote workers, freelancers, and families looking to streamline their communication setup. One of the standout advantages of home VoIP services is their cost-effectiveness. Traditional landlines often come with hefty installation fees, long-term contracts, and hidden charges. In contrast, VoIP services typically offer transparent pricing, with many providers offering unlimited calling plans for a flat monthly fee. Additionally, international calls are significantly cheaper, making VoIP an ideal choice for households with relatives abroad. Another key benefit is the portability of VoIP systems. Unlike landlines, which are tied to a physical location, VoIP services can be accessed from anywhere with an internet connection. This means you can take your home number with you when traveling or moving, ensuring you never miss an important call. Many providers also offer mobile apps, allowing you to make and receive calls directly from your smartphone.
